Software Developer at Colliers Engineering & Design

1 year ago Development & Programming Middle Full-Time 70,000-162,000 $/Year

As an Software Developer you will be responsible for developing critical software applications for our internal clients and offers excellent technical support.


Qualifications

  • Bachelor’s degree in Computer Science / Computer Information Systems or related field.
  • 3-5 years of experience of development using C# and ASP.NET 5,6 including experience with VS Code and/or Visual Studio.
  • Strong experience designing/developing relational databases and SQL coding in both Microsoft SQL Server including use of Entity Framework migrations.
  • Experience using typescript based client frameworks React, Angular or ASP.NET Web Forms and REST based Services.
  • General SharePoint knowledge, in particular using SharePoint framework to develop web parts and SharePoint Web Services.
  • Web Interface Design, HTML, JavaScript/Typescript, XML and CSS experience.
  • Knowledge of IT systems including a general technical knowledge of hardware, software, databases and database technologies.


Description

As an Software Developer you will be responsible for developing critical software applications for our internal clients and offers excellent technical support. Responsibilities include following the software development lifecycle (SDLC) to plan, design, build, test, and deploy software applications, ranging from websites and PC applications to web applications.

Responsibilities

  • Gathering information from customers or business leaders to meet needs
  • Collaborating with management, departments and customers to identify end-user requirements and specifications
  • Ensuring software works properly after maintenance and testing
  • Strategizing and building releases for future upgrades and maintenance
  • Producing efficient and elegant code based on requirements
  • Testing and deploying programs and applications
  • Troubleshooting, debugging, maintaining and improving existing software
  • Compiling and assessing user feedback to improve software performance
  • Observing user feedback to recommend improvements to existing software products
  • Developing technical documentation to guide future software development projects

What We Offer

At Colliers Engineering & Design, our people are our most important resource. That’s why we are committed to providing all our employees with a safe, comfortable work environment, potential for career advancement, and the ability to impact society through their projects as well as Company sponsored activities.

This dedication begins with supporting a work life balance through a generous compensation package that includes: company paid medical, dental, and vision coverage; paid pregnancy disability leave; short- and long-term disability insurance; life insurance; a company-matched 401(k)/Roth; paid time off that includes parental and military leave; employee referral and professional license bonuses and a straight time policy that compensates exempt employees for billable hours worked in excess of 40 billable hours within a work week.

We have also created an internal culture that provides the resources and technology needed to encourage personal and professional growth opportunities through reimbursement for education; a free in-house resource for hundreds of educational and self-enrichment courses; mentorship program; wellness program; Women’s Organization and ongoing philanthropic opportunities.

Job Type: Full-time

Pay: $70,401.00 - $162,839.00 per year

Benefits:

  • Dental insurance
  • Health insurance
  • Paid time off
  • Vision insurance

Schedule:

8 hour shift

Monday to Friday

Experience:

  • REST: 1 year (Preferred)
  • Java: 1 year (Preferred)

🎉 Let Employers Find You!

Employers will see your profile when they are sending a job in your skill.


Create Your Profile   (simple)